@font-face { font-family: "Roboto Slab"; font-weight: 100;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-t.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-t.woff") format("woff");}
@font-face { font-family: "Roboto Slab"; font-weight: 200;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-e-l.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-e-l.woff") format("woff");}
@font-face { font-family: "Roboto Slab"; font-weight: 300;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-l.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-l.woff") format("woff");}
@font-face { font-family: "Roboto Slab"; font-weight: 400;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-r.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-r.woff") format("woff");}
@font-face { font-family: "Roboto Slab"; font-weight: 500;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-m.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-m.woff") format("woff");}
@font-face { font-family: "Roboto Slab"; font-weight: 600;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-s-b.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-s-b.woff") format("woff");}
@font-face { font-family: "Roboto Slab"; font-weight: 700;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-b.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-b.woff") format("woff");}
@font-face { font-family: "Roboto Slab"; font-weight: 800;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-e-b.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-e-b.woff") format("woff");}
@font-face { font-family: "Roboto Slab"; font-weight: 900; font-style: normal; font-display: swap; src: url("/g/fonts/roboto_slab/roboto_slab-bl.woff2") format("woff2"), url("/g/fonts/roboto_slab/roboto_slab-bl.woff") format("woff");}
:root {
	--color-iglmbzfdx: 255, 255, 255;
	--color-ilvz4fvis: 15, 15, 15;
	--color-icawfch49: 61, 65, 73;
	--color-i01sqvhmk: 0, 0, 0;
	--color-i1nnpk617: 255, 255, 255;
	--color-i8rlwm027: 255, 255, 255;
	--color-icvw464tp: 255, 255, 255;
	--color-ig54jr9h1: 0, 0, 0;
	--color-isa00iu9a: 56, 163, 204;
}

.link-universal--u-ifx69ldb2 { display: -webkit-box; display: -ms-flexbox; display: flex; cursor: pointer; text-decoration-line: none; margin-top: 0px; -webkit-box-orient: vertical; -webkit-box-direction: normal; -ms-flex-direction: column; flex-direction: column; margin-bottom: 0px }
.text--u-ir9m09pjt { display: -webkit-box; display: -ms-flexbox; display: flex; font-size: 28px; line-height: normal; vertical-align: top; position: relative; color: rgba(var(--color-iglmbzfdx), 1); font-weight: 700;  -webkit-box-align: center; -ms-flex-align: center; align-items: center; text-transform: uppercase }
.div--u-ijsep5bd1 { width: 380px; position: relative; background-color: rgba(var(--color-ilvz4fvis), 0); padding-left: 40px; padding-right: 40px; padding-bottom: 40px; padding-top: 40px; flex-shrink: 0; color: rgba(var(--color-icawfch49), 1); cursor: auto; font-family: Roboto Slab, serif; font-size: 16px; font-style: normal; font-weight: 400; letter-spacing: normal; line-height: normal; overflow-wrap: break-word; text-align: left; text-indent: 0px; text-shadow: none; text-transform: none }
.text--u-i6qtgwdfu { display: -webkit-box; display: -ms-flexbox; display: flex; vertical-align: top; position: relative; margin-top: 45px; color: rgba(var(--color-i1nnpk617), 1); font-weight: 100; font-size: 20px }
.text--u-ibqcukxz7 { display: -webkit-box; display: -ms-flexbox; display: flex; vertical-align: top; position: relative; text-transform: uppercase; font-size: 35px; font-weight: 100; color: rgba(var(--color-i8rlwm027), 1) }
.div--u-ilatl6r59 { width: 3px; position: relative; display: block; margin-top: 39px; background-color: rgba(var(--color-icvw464tp), 1); height: 200px; margin-bottom: -198px }
.link-universal--u-iv3mra2kk { display: -webkit-box; display: -ms-flexbox; display: flex; cursor: pointer; text-decoration-line: none; max-width: 140px; max-height: 140px }
.imageFit--u-i3ef5dqw6 { position: relative; display: inline-block; vertical-align: top; overflow-x: visible; overflow-y: visible; max-width: 100%; max-height: 100% }
.imageFit__img--u-iwc9nib4x { object-fit: contain; width: 100%; height: 100% }
.imageFit__overlay--u-i1n264eyy { display: none; position: absolute; left: 0px; right: 0px; top: 0px; bottom: 0px; background-color: rgba(var(--color-ig54jr9h1), 0.4) }
.imageFit__zoom--u-i5te8muvd { display: none; position: absolute; right: 10px; bottom: 10px; width: 20px; height: 20px; background-color: rgba(var(--color-isa00iu9a), 1) }
.svg_image--u-itfpren3y { position: relative; display: -webkit-inline-box; display: -ms-inline-flexbox; display: inline-flex; vertical-align: top; justify-content: center;  -webkit-box-align: center; -ms-flex-align: center; align-items: center; height: 20px; width: 20px; overflow-x: hidden; overflow-y: hidden }
.svg_image--u-itfpren3y svg { flex-shrink: 0; width: 100%; height: 100% }

@media (max-width: 991px) {
	.text--u-ir9m09pjt { text-align: left; padding-top: 5px; padding-bottom: 5px; justify-content: flex-start }
	.text--u-ibqcukxz7 { font-size: 20px }
}

@media (max-width: 767px) {
	.text--u-ir9m09pjt { text-align: center; font-size: 21px; margin-top: 10px }
	.div--u-ijsep5bd1 { width: auto; padding-bottom: 19px; display: -webkit-box; display: -ms-flexbox; display: flex; -webkit-box-orient: vertical; -webkit-box-direction: normal; -ms-flex-direction: column; flex-direction: column;  -webkit-box-align: center; -ms-flex-align: center; align-items: center; justify-content: center }
	.text--u-i6qtgwdfu { text-align: center; margin-top: 6px }
	.text--u-ibqcukxz7 { text-align: center }
	.div--u-ilatl6r59 { display: none }
}

@media (max-width: 479px) {
	.text--u-ir9m09pjt { text-align: center; font-size: 17px; margin-top: 10px }
}